It's the start of William Worthington's second year at The Jolly Theatre School and he and the rest of the students demand to have new school uniforms because they've all grown out of last years' clothes.
When the class isn't allowed to practice any sports, they find a way to exercise during a performance of Hamlet. Humphrey's performance even earns him an award.
The students are desperately trying to collect money to save The Jolly Theatre School from going out of business. In the end, the Jolly sisters receive aid from an unexpected source: Stanley Spadley, the school janitor.
